A roaster oven is a type of countertop electric oven that is specifically designed for roasting, baking, and slow cooking.
It is similar to a conventional oven, but it is smaller in size and operates at a lower temperature, which makes it ideal for slow cooking and roasting meats and vegetables.
best Roaster ovens typically have a removable pan and rack, which makes it easy to lift the food out of the oven and transfer it to a serving dish.
Some models also have a self-basting lid, which helps to keep the food moist and tender as it cooks.
Roaster ovens are a convenient and energy-efficient alternative to using a full-size oven, and they are often used for cooking large cuts of meat, such as turkey or roast beef, as well as for baking cakes and other desserts.

what size roaster oven should I buy?
The size of the roaster oven you should buy will depend on your needs and the size of your kitchen.
In general, a 22-quart roaster oven is suitable for cooking a turkey or a large roast and can feed up to 20 people. A 16-quart oven is suitable for cooking a chicken or a small roast and can feed up to 12 people.
A 6-quart oven is suitable for cooking small dishes, such as a casserole or a roast chicken, and can feed up to 6 people.
What temperature range should an electric roaster oven have?

Most electric roaster ovens have temperature settings that range from 200 to 450 degrees Fahrenheit.
The low end of this range is suitable for slow cooking and roasting at a low temperature, while the high end is suitable for roasting and baking at a higher temperature.
Some roaster ovens may have a “warm” setting that maintains a temperature of around 200 degrees Fahrenheit, which is useful for keeping cooked food warm until it is ready to be served.
It’s important to note that the actual temperature of the oven may vary slightly from the temperature indicated on the control panel.
To ensure accurate cooking, it’s a good idea to use an oven thermometer to verify the temperature of the oven.
This is especially important when cooking meat, as cooking at the wrong temperature can result in under or overcooked food.

self-basting lid
A self-basting lid is a feature found on some roaster ovens that helps to keep the food moist and tender as it cooks.
The lid is designed with a series of small holes or channels that allow steam to escape from the oven, which helps to prevent the food from becoming too moist.
At the same time, the steam that escapes from the oven helps to baste the food, which helps to keep it moist and flavorful.
Some self-basting lids also have a built-in thermometer, which allows you to monitor the temperature of the food as it cooks.
Self-basting lids are particularly useful for cooking large cuts of meat, such as turkey or roast beef, as they help to keep the meat moist and tender as it cooks.
They are also useful for cooking other types of dishes, such as casseroles and stews, which can benefit from being kept moist as they cook.

how to clean roaster oven
Cleaning an electric roaster oven is generally relatively easy, especially if the oven has a non-stick surface and removable parts. Here are a few tips for cleaning an electric roaster oven:
- Allow the oven to cool: Before you start cleaning the oven, make sure it has had time to cool completely. This will help to prevent any accidents or burns.
- Remove any food debris: Use a spatula or a spoon to remove any food debris or scraps from the oven chamber.
- Wipe down the surface: Use a damp cloth or sponge to wipe down the surface of the oven, including the control panel and the handles.
- Clean the pan and rack: If the pan and rack are removable, you can wash them by hand or place them in the dishwasher. If they are not removable, you can use a soft scrub brush or a sponge to scrub away any food debris.
- Dry the oven: Once you have finished cleaning the oven, make sure to dry it thoroughly to prevent rust or other damage.
Overall, cleaning an electric roaster oven is generally a straightforward process as long as you follow these basic steps. If you have any concerns about cleaning the oven, you can refer to the manufacturer’s instructions for more detailed guidance.
